AEW Dynamite on Wednesday night drew 759,000 viewers on TNT according to Nielsen. NXT on the USA Network drew 580,000 on a night when Game 7 of the World Series drew over 23 million viewers on Fox. It was the lowest rating for both wrestling telecasts. Notably, the ratings for the Game 7 World Series […]

WWE reports Q3 earnings
The WWE announced its 3rd quarter earnings for 2019 on Thursday. The company beat analyst estimates on its projected earnings, but they are still down compared to last year. The company announced revenues of $186.3 million in comparison to $188.4 million in 2018. The operating income was $6.4 million with the adjusted OIBDA (Operating Income […]

Dana White’s Contender Series coming to Asia in 2020
The UFC has announced that it will launch its first ever Dana White’s Contender Series Asia in 2020. The events will air at the UFC Performance Institute in Shanghai, China. Cat Zingano signs with Bellator
Former UFC women’s bantamweight title contender Cat Zingano is heading to Bellator. Zingano signed a multi-fight deal with the Viacom-owned company and will be in the women’s featherweight division.
